Using FP2002, my home page uses the exact same button style (An HTML
style where each link is enclosed in brackets) as other pages in the
web. When I view the page in editor mode or preview mode, the buttons
looks OK. Then when I save the page to the server, they go back to the
web theme buttons. I've tried everything I can think of --
delete/re-add nav bar, create new page, etc. I 1st thought it may be
the FP server extensions but the other pages look fine. I even
compared the html locally with "view source" off the server. The html
looks like this:
<!--webbot bot="Navigation" S-Type="children"
S-Orientation="horizontal" S-Rendering="html" B-Include-Home="FALSE"
B-Include-Up="FALSE" S-Btn-Nml="[&lt;A HREF=&quot;#URL#&quot;
TARGET=&quot;#TARGET#&quot; STYLE=&quot;{text-decoration:
none;}&quot;&gt;#LABEL#&lt;/A&gt;]" S-Btn-Sel="[#LABEL#]"
S-Btn-Sep="&amp;nbsp;" S-Bar="Brackets" -->

Any ideas what's wrong?
 
S

Stefan B Rusynko

If you are using the new FP2002 Link bars the host server requires the FP2002 SE
